The full form of OTP is One Time Password. OTP is a unique and temporary code that is used to authenticate users during specific transactions. It is a type of security password that is valid only for a single-use or transaction and on a single computer, mobile device, etc., which is used for the transaction. OTP provides an extra layer of security while using your debit cards, credit cards for online transactions such as mobile recharge, online shopping, paying bills, etc. . It is typically a 4 to 6 digit code that is sent to the users registered mobile number or email address. OTPs may replace authentication login information or may be used in addition to it to add another layer of security. OTPs are more secure than static passwords, especially user-created passwords, which can be weak and/or reused across multiple accounts. The OTP system employs algorithms that generate random valid codes for a limited period of time. There are three primary methods of generating OTPs: Time-based OTP (TOTP), HMAC-based OTP (HOTP), and SMS-based OTP.
